Crews take on 6,000-acre wildfire in Converse Co.

Fire crews are fighting a new wildfire in Converse County. The Little Boxelder Fire about 10 miles south of Glenrock has burned about 6,000 acres of grass and timber since it was first reported last Friday. It is about 20% contained. State Forestry Division spokeswoman Kathy Lujan says the fire initially threatened some rural ranch homes. But thanks to efforts by some 100 firefighters, the homes are no longer threatened. Elsewhere, there was a lot of wildfire activity in the state over the weekend, especially in Goshen, Fremont and Albany counties. But quick responses by firefighters kept the fires in check.
